A 2.20 kg bucket containing 10.0 kg of water is hanging from a vertical ideal spring of force constant120 N/m and oscillating up and down with an amplitude of 3.00 {\rm cm}. Suddenly the bucket springs a leak in the bottom such that water drops out at a steady rate of 2.00 {\rm{ g/s}}.

a) When the bucket is half full, find the period of oscillation.

b) When the bucket is half full, find the rate at which the period is changing with respect to time.

c) What is the shortest period this system can have?
